Messiah Prophet Messiah Prophet
a Hard Rock, Christian Metal band from Pennsylvania, USA   flag 

Last Update: April 03, 2008

info

Originally known as the Messiah Prophet Band, this Pennsylvania group formed in the late seventies by bassist Dean Pellman, a veteran of the local Christian music scene at the time. He put together a lineup and recorded Rock The Flock in 1984, and eventually they signed to the fledgling Christian label Pure Metal (also home to Bride and Saint), releasing their best-known album, Master To The Metal, in 1986. Even by 80's standards Master is pretty dated and ordinary, adopting a standard hard rock/accessible metal style with the expected heavily Christian lyrics. The band petered out in the late eighties, but many years later manager Ray Fletcher (who, it has been said, basically owned the name and ran the band) recruited an entirely new lineup (only one member, guitarist Frank Caloairo, had any connection with the old band, having toured with them once upon a time), and that lineup released the very different Colors album in 1996.
